Árbol de páginas

Estás viendo una versión antigua de esta página. Ve a la versión actual.

Comparar con el actual Ver el historial de la página

« Anterior Versión 8 Siguiente »

Aquí mostraremos los cambios que se han hecho en el arquetipo, debidos a cambios en la imagen corporativa o a corrección de errores, que es importante hacer en nuestros proyectos basados en arquetipos anteriores, y la adaptación que se debería realizar en algunos archivos del arquetipo para adaptarlo a la versión actual.

La versión del arquetipo con el que se generó la aplicación se puede ver en el archivo pom del proyecto padre.

Desde arquetipo versión 0.0.16-0.0.18:

Cambios:

Con estos cambios se modifica el menú y los espacios exteriores de la página para que se adapten mejor cuando la ventana tiene un tamaño reducido.

Adaptación a la versión 0.0.19:

1.- Cambiar el archivo menu.js por el siguiente: menu.js (Este paso ya no es necesario si se va a actualizar hasta la 0.0.24)

2.- Cambiar el archivo template.xhtml para añadir esta línea después del div con class sidebar:

<div class="sidebar">
    ...
</div>
<span class="mainMenu-bg"></span>
<div class="main-content">
    ...



Desde arquetipo versión 0.0.19:

Cambios:

Con estos cambios se añade el fichero primefaces_fix.js a las plantillas, para solucionar un fallo, que tiene primefaces y JSF, a la hora de actualizar toda un pagina mediante un partial-submit.

Adaptación a la versión actual:

1.- Cambiar el archivo template.xhtml y template_login.xhtml para añadir esta línea después de <f:facet name="last">:

<f:facet name="last">
    <h:outputScript library="fundeweb" name="primefaces/js/primefaces_fix.js" />
    ...

Desde arquetipo versión 0.0.20-0.0.23:

Cambios:

El fichero menu.js pasa a estar en la librería, para facilitar su modificación.
Se pasa a usar la versión 1.1 del estilo corporativo, que se distribuye en la librería fundeweb-tags-primefaces8 a partir de la versión 2.0.131.

Adaptación a la versión actual:

Es necesario tener la librería fundeweb-tags-primefaces8 actualizada.

1.- En el archivo template.xhtml:

Se quitan los archivos del estilo antiguos y el h:outputScript de menu.js y se añaden los nuevos:

                <fdw:outputStylesheet library="themes" name="um/1_1/css/font.css" />
<fdw:outputStylesheet library="themes" name="um/1_1/css/layoutUMU.css" />
<fdw:outputStylesheet library="themes" name="um/1_1/css/estiloUMU.css" />
<h:outputScript library="themes" name="um/1_1/js/estiloUMU.js" />
<h:outputScript library="themes" name="um/1_1/js/menu.js" />

Se cambian los elementos del pie de página para adecuarlo mejor a móvil.

Se cambian las propiedades de los diálogos de cierre de sesión (noSesionDlg y cerrandoSesionDlg) para mejorar su posición en pantalla.

Con estos cambios quedaría la versión 0.0.24 del template.xhtml.

2.- En el archivo cabecera.xhtml:

Añadida posibilidad de poner nombre secundario a la aplicación, si se hace este cambio hay que añadir la propiedad application.name.secondary en los ficheros properties.

Cambiado el aspecto del botón salir.

Se pueden ver estos cambios en la versión 0.0.24 de cabecera.xhtml.

3.- Se cambian los archivos recomendaciones.xhtml y lopd.xhtml:

Se mejora la visualización en móvil.

Se pueden ver estos cambios en la versiones 0.024 de recomendaciones.xhtmllopd.xhtml

Versión 1.1 del estilo (arquetipo 0.0.24):

Cambios:

No necesita cambios.

  • Sin etiquetas